Why These Are the Top Walk-in Tubs Contractors in Tickfaw

** The walk-in tub market in Tickfaw, Louisiana, is characterized by a reliance on regional providers from larger hubs like Hammond, Baton Rouge, and Covington. There are no dedicated walk-in tub companies physically located within Tickfaw's city limits. The competition level is moderate, with a handful of established, reputable companies vying for business in this niche market. The average quality of service is high, as these companies rely on strong reputations and word-of-mouth in a tightly-knit regional community. Typical pricing for a complete walk-in tub solution (tub unit plus professional installation) in this region generally starts from **$4,500** for a basic, non-jetted model and can range up to **$12,000 - $15,000** or more for high-end models featuring hydrotherapy jets, heated surfaces, and quick-drain technology. The final cost is highly dependent on the complexity of the installation, the need for any structural bathroom modifications, and the specific features of the tub selected. Most reputable providers offer financing options to help manage the upfront cost.

Frequently Asked Questions About Walk-in Tubs in Tickfaw

Get answers to common questions about walk-in tubs services in Tickfaw, Louisiana.

1What is the typical cost range for a walk-in tub installation in Tickfaw, and are there any local factors that affect the price?

In the Tickfaw area, a complete walk-in tub install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000+, depending on the tub model, features, and necessary bathroom modifications. Local factors that can influence cost include the age and layout of your home's plumbing (common in older Louisiana houses), potential need for additional structural support in humid climates, and whether your installation requires a water heater upgrade to accommodate the tub's larger capacity for a hot soak.

2How long does a full walk-in tub installation take for a homeowner in Tickfaw?

A professional installation by a licensed local provider usually takes 1 to 3 full days. The timeline can be affected by Louisiana's humid climate, as proper sealing and waterproofing are critical to prevent mold and may require extra drying time. Scheduling installations outside of the peak hurricane season (June-November) is also advisable, as severe weather can delay both material deliveries and contractor availability.

3Are there specific permits or regulations for installing a walk-in tub in Tickfaw, Louisiana?

Yes, most installations in unincorporated areas of Tangipahoa Parish (like Tickfaw) require a basic plumbing permit, and electrical permits if adding jets or heaters. Reputable local installers will handle this process. It's crucial to ensure your provider is licensed by the Louisiana State Licensing Board for Contractors, as this guarantees they understand state and local building codes, which are important for safety and future home resale.
